What Are Ultrasonic Solar-Powered Gopher Repellents and How Do They Work?
Ultrasonic solar-powered gopher repellents are devices designed to deter gophers from invading gardens and lawns using sound waves and solar energy.
- Ultrasonic Technology: These devices emit high-frequency sound waves that are inaudible to humans but irritating to gophers and other burrowing animals.
- Solar Power: They are equipped with solar panels that charge the internal batteries, allowing for sustainable operation without the need for external power sources.
- Coverage Area: Many ultrasonic solar-powered gopher repellents cover a significant area, often ranging from 6,000 to 7,500 square feet, making them effective for larger yards.
- Weather Resistance: These devices are typically designed to withstand various weather conditions, ensuring durability and consistent performance in rain or shine.
- Eco-Friendly Solution: As they don’t involve chemicals or traps, these repellents provide an environmentally friendly approach to pest control, safeguarding beneficial wildlife and plants.
Ultrasonic technology works by generating sound waves at frequencies that disrupt the communication and navigation of gophers, encouraging them to relocate to quieter areas. This method is favored for its humane approach, as it does not harm the animals but rather dissuades them from returning.
The solar power feature allows these devices to function independently, making them cost-effective and easy to maintain. Users can simply place them in direct sunlight, and they will recharge automatically, ensuring continuous operation without frequent battery replacements.
The coverage area of these repellents is significant, making them suitable for various landscapes, from small gardens to larger fields. This feature helps ensure that the ultrasonic waves can effectively reach the burrowing animals, maximizing the deterrent effect.
Weather resistance is a vital characteristic, as it ensures the device can operate effectively under different environmental conditions. Most models are built to endure rain, snow, and extreme sunlight, providing reliable pest control year-round.
Lastly, being an eco-friendly solution, these repellents offer a safe alternative to traditional pest control methods, which often involve harmful chemicals. By using sound waves, they protect not only the target species but also the surrounding ecosystem, making them a popular choice among environmentally conscious consumers.

How Effective Are Ultrasonic Solar-Powered Gopher Repellents in Real-life Scenarios?
Ultrasonic solar-powered gopher repellents are increasingly popular for their eco-friendliness and effectiveness in deterring gophers. The effectiveness of these devices can vary based on several factors:
- Frequency Range: The ultrasonic devices typically emit sound waves in a frequency range of 20 kHz to 65 kHz, which is beyond the hearing range of humans but can be perceived by gophers.
- Solar-Powered Operation: These repellents harness solar energy to function, making them efficient and sustainable, as they do not require battery replacements or external power sources.
- Sound Wave Patterns: Many models use intermittent sound patterns that can confuse or irritate gophers, encouraging them to leave the area.
- Placement Considerations: The effectiveness can depend on the placement of the devices; they need to be strategically positioned to cover areas where gopher activity is observed.
- Environmental Factors: Soil type, moisture, and surrounding vegetation can influence the transmission of ultrasonic waves, affecting how well the repellent works.
- Longevity and Durability: Since these devices are often left outdoors, their materials should withstand various weather conditions, affecting their long-term effectiveness.
The frequency range is crucial as it determines whether gophers can detect the sound; the right frequencies can lead to successful repelling. In many cases, users report mixed results, as some gophers may become acclimated to the sounds over time.
Solar-powered operation is a significant advantage, as it eliminates the need for external power sources. This feature not only reduces maintenance costs but also ensures the device can operate continuously during the day, maximizing its effectiveness.
Sound wave patterns are designed to disrupt the gopher’s habitat and can lead to discomfort, prompting them to vacate the area. However, the efficacy may vary based on the specific model and the consistency of the sound emitted.
Placement is critical for these devices; they should be positioned where gopher activity is highest. Incorrect placement can result in reduced effectiveness, as the ultrasonic waves might not reach the burrows where gophers reside.
Environmental factors can either enhance or hinder performance, as dense vegetation or certain soil types can absorb or reflect sound waves, impacting how far the ultrasonic frequencies travel.
Longevity and durability are essential for ensuring that these repellents remain functional over time. Devices made from high-quality materials are more likely to withstand the elements, providing reliable results throughout their intended lifespan.

What Durability Features Should A Repellent Have?
The best gopher repellent ultrasonic solar powered devices should incorporate several key durability features to ensure long-lasting performance.
- Weather Resistance: A quality repellent should be designed to withstand various weather conditions, including rain, snow, and extreme temperatures. This ensures that the device continues to function effectively without degradation caused by moisture or temperature fluctuations.
- UV Protection: Prolonged exposure to sunlight can damage electronic components and the outer casing of the repellent. Devices with UV protection are built to resist sun damage, maintaining their integrity and performance over time.
- Robust Construction: The physical build of the repellent should be sturdy, often made from high-quality materials like ABS plastic or metal. This resilience helps protect against physical impacts or burrowing animals, which could otherwise compromise the device.
- Battery Longevity: Solar-powered units should feature efficient battery systems that can store energy effectively for prolonged use, even on cloudy days. A durable battery allows the device to operate continuously without the need for frequent maintenance or replacement.
- Sealed Components: Internal elements, such as wiring and circuitry, should be sealed to prevent damage from dirt, moisture, and pests. This protection is crucial for maintaining the functionality of the device in outdoor environments.
- Easy Maintenance and Installation: A well-designed repellent should allow for simple installation and maintenance, ensuring that users can replace batteries or make adjustments without specialized tools. This user-friendly design contributes to the overall durability and effectiveness of the device.
